Vitamins and supplements tested to boost heart surgery recovery

NCT ID NCT06995586

First seen May 15, 2026 · Last updated May 15, 2026

Summary

This study tests whether adding Vitamin C, Omega-3 fatty acids, and other supplements to standard care can improve recovery in 108 adults after coronary artery bypass surgery. Participants will take the supplements daily for 10 weeks starting 15 days after surgery. The goal is to see if this combination reduces complications and improves well-being.
